BLUSTER noun

Definition of bluster (noun)

  1. noisy confusion and turbulence
    • "he was awakened by the bluster of their preparations"
  2. a swaggering show of courage
  3. a violent gusty wind
  4. vain and empty boasting

BLUSTER verb

Definition of bluster (verb)

  1. blow hard; be gusty, as of wind
    • "A southeaster blustered onshore"; "The flames blustered"
  2. show off
  3. act in an arrogant, overly self-assured, or conceited manner
